Just took DSST Money & Banking - Trajan - 05-01-2006

I just took Money & Banking. All in all it was not as difficult as I thought it would be. There were many questions on the Fed, Keynesian economics, Bank acts etc. It was a very broad exam, many topics were covered. I had to guess at around 10-15 questions that were not covered in my studies. I left the testing center feeling that I passed, we'll see in 2 weeks! Big Grin

Thanks Libarts! thanks Snazzlefrag! I would agree that it was a difficult test,but not one of the most difficult in my opinion. I think it was a little harder than Macroeconomics, given the broad range of topics covered. I used instantcert, the Rudman book, Wikipedia and I read 3/4 of a textbook to prepare.
